UniversalKit still uses Toolkit functions that transfer tokens to ERC-20 custody or TSS directly. Update the components to use evmDepositAndCall, zetachainWithdrawAndCall and other Toolkit functions to interact with universal apps through Gateway, instead. This mostly is related to the Swap component.